Cold Room Maintenance: Preventing Downtime and Extending Lifespan

Regular inspection of your refrigerated space is essential for avoiding costly outages and maximizing its longevity. Overlooking even slight issues can quickly escalate into major problems, causing inventory damage and substantial repairs . A proactive maintenance plan should include the following:

  • Regular wiping of cooling units to promote efficient cooling capacity .
  • Checking weatherstripping for wear and fixing them as needed .
  • Observing temperature readings to identify any anomalies .
  • Oiling fans to decrease friction .
  • Scheduling certified checks at recommended times.

By allocating time and resources to consistent cold room care , you can protect your investment and preserve a dependable cooling solution.

The Future of Refrigeration and Cold Chain Logistics

The evolving scene of refrigeration and cold chain logistics is poised for major alteration, driven by rising demand for perishable goods and a greater focus on eco-friendliness. We’re seeing a move away from older vapor-compression systems towards advanced technologies like magnetic refrigeration and ultra-low temperature cooling. In addition, the integration of Internet of Things (IoT) is allowing real-time visibility of product status throughout the entire journey, leading to better preservation and reduced loss. See a greater reliance on renewable energy sources driving these systems and more emphasis on packaging innovations that lessen the carbon footprint.
